Where to Use with Caution

While Illustration Christmas Design 10 is versatile, it’s not always the best fit for every situation. For instance, in formal corporate branding, its playful nature may clash with a more serious tone. Similarly, in text-heavy ads or layouts with dense information, it might distract from the main message. It also requires careful placement on mobile screens, where smaller sizes can diminish its impact.

Design Notes for Professional Use

As a brand designer, I recommend testing Illustration Christmas Design 10 against your brand’s color palette to ensure it complements rather than competes. Check how it looks in black and white to confirm its versatility. Place it within real campaign mockups to see how it interacts with other elements. Preview it on mobile devices to ensure it scales well and remains legible at smaller sizes.
